What are three major concepts established by the Declaration of Independence ?

Respuesta :

strife2
strife2 strife2
  • 22-02-2019

concept 1: All people are created equal

concept 2: All people have basic rights that cannot be taken away

concept 3: The government gets its power to make decisions and to protect rights from the people

concept 4: When the government does not protect the rights of the people, the people have the right to change or remove the government
